Algorithm


Problem Name: Sql - Average Population of Each Continent

Problem Link: https://www.hackerrank.com/challenges/average-population-of-each-continent/problem?isFullScreen=true

In this HackerRank Functions in SQL problem solution,

Given the CITY and COUNTRY tables, query the names of all the continents (COUNTRY.Continent) and their respective average city populations (CITY.Population) rounded down to the nearest integer.

Note: CITY.CountryCode and COUNTRY.Code are matching key columns.

Input Format

The CITY and COUNTRY tables are described as follows:

 

 

Code Examples

#1 Code Example with MySQL

Code - MySQL


SELECT COUNTRY.CONTINENT, FLOOR(AVG(CITY.POPULATION))
FROM CITY INNER JOIN COUNTRY
ON CITY.COUNTRYCODE = COUNTRY.CODE
GROUP BY COUNTRY.CONTINENT;
Copy The Code & Try With Live Editor
Advertisements

Demonstration


Previous
[Solved] African Cities in SQL solution in Hackerrank
Next
[Solved] Java Arraylist in Java solution in Hackerrank - Hacerrank solution Java